## Static-Analysis Baseline

The Gravelpoint linter compares each run against `baseline.sarif` at the repo root. Regenerate it only after deliberate rule changes, never to silence new findings. Regeneration requires pulling suppression records from the findings database, since historical waivers live there rather than in the file. Point the regen script at the database with the connection string below.

primary connection of yagep-kahip = redis://giliel_svc:zYiKsLL2PLpfPL@db-348f.xolmarsys.corp:5432/fenwyn

## Onboarding — Markdown Pipeline (Inkmere)

Inkmere docs render through a three-stage pipeline: parse, sanitize, emit. Releases rebuild all templates; never hot-patch emitted HTML. Broken renders usually mean a sanitizer rule change — check the rules diff first. The render cluster only accepts builds from the release channel, and every build artifact must be signed before upload. Sign artifacts with the deploy key below.

release key, hafop-tajef: bky13_s2vaFVNJTHfBL

// Plugin authors: do not override GPS, serial, or owner-name tags; Pixelgate
// removes them unconditionally before your hooks run. Orientation is
// normalized, then dropped. Color profile tags survive. If your plugin
// re-embeds metadata post-scrub, uploads fail validation at the Harkwell
// edge and the asset is quarantined. Test against the staging scrubber,
// not production. Keep transforms idempotent; the scrubber may re-run on
// retries. The scrubber version is stamped below.

session token of tajef-bageg = htk21_5d90d574934f3ccae6437

Ticket TRNS-2291: Expired credentials on the Gravelmoor transcoding farm. All twelve worker nodes stopped pulling jobs from the Spoolhaven queue at 03:14 because the shared service credential lapsed. Maintainers should note: this credential is not auto-rotated; it expires every 90 days and must be renewed manually via the Keyforge console. We have renewed it and restarted the workers, and jobs are draining normally. To avoid repeat outages, set a calendar reminder 80 days out. The replacement key for the farm is recorded below.

service key, fawip-bajef: kto11_Qt5wZK9vdNC